Trailer Reaction: The Foreigner


I didn't realized how much I loved Jackie Chan till I saw The Foreigner trailer. And considering that I'm seeing him in REAL LIFE at Beyond Fest, I couldn't resist doing a trailer reaction for his new film! Based on the 1992 novel, The Chinaman by Stephen Leather, the film follows Quan Ngoc Minh, a business with a buried past who seeks justice when his daughter is killed in an act of terrorism. A cat-and-mouse conflict ensues with a government official (Pierce Brosnan), whose past may hold clues to the killers' identities.

I don't think Jackie has released a film in the United States since The Karate Kid starring Jaden Smith so naturally, I'm incredibly elated to see him in another film. While we know Jackie as the goofball action star, The Foreigner shows a darker and serious side to him and I'm loving it already! And I am not going to lie, I almost cried watching this trailer because Jackie reminds me so much of my own father. I can't wait to watch serious Jackie in action!
